Why dead mice removal matters

Hidden risks in Marsden Park homes and businesses

Marsden Park’s mix of older fibro homes, newer estates, and commercial properties creates ideal conditions for mice to nest in wall cavities, roof spaces, and storage areas. When a mouse dies in these hidden spots, the odour can spread quickly through living areas, making spaces unusable and posing health risks.

Dead mice in garages, sheds, or under floorboards often go unnoticed until the smell becomes overwhelming. In restaurants or food storage areas, even a small carcass can contaminate surfaces and attract flies, creating a sanitation issue that requires immediate attention.

Health and sanitation risks of dead mice in Marsden Park

A dead mouse in your home or business isn’t just unpleasant — it can pose real health and sanitation risks. Here’s what you need to know.

  • Strong, lingering odour that worsens over time
  • Flies gathering around a specific area indoors or outdoors
  • Unexplained damp spots or stains on walls or ceilings
  • Scratching or scurrying sounds in walls or roof spaces

In Marsden Park’s older homes, dead mice in wall cavities can cause odours to spread through the entire house. In commercial kitchens or storage areas, even a small carcass can contaminate surfaces and attract pests. The longer you wait, the harder and more expensive it becomes to resolve.
